[Simplified approach to ablation in atrial flutter using a single catheter electrode. Based on 70 cases]
J P Albenque1, J P Donzeau, C Goutner
1Clinique Pasteur, Toulouse.
Summary
This study found radiofrequency ablation effectively treats common atrial flutter using a single catheter, achieving a 100% initial success rate. While recurrence occurred in 13% of patients, the method proved feasible and safe.

Context:
- Common atrial flutter (AFL) is a common supraventricular tachycardia.
- Radiofrequency ablation (RFA) is effective but recurrence rates vary.
- Costly materials for achieving conduction block in the isthmus are a concern.
Purpose:
- To assess the feasibility, efficacy, and risks of RFA for common AFL using a single catheter electrode.
- To evaluate a cost-effective RFA approach without compromising efficacy.
- To determine the recurrence rate and safety of this ablation technique.
Summary:
- Seventy patients with drug-resistant common AFL underwent RFA guided by anatomical and electrophysiological criteria.
- Ablation continued until microvoltage atrial activity along the isthmus was achieved, not just flutter termination.
- Initial AFL interruption was 100%, with a 13% recurrence rate after six months' follow-up.
Impact:
- Demonstrates a feasible and effective single-catheter RFA strategy for common AFL.
- Offers a potentially less costly alternative to multi-catheter techniques for isthmic conduction block.
- Highlights the safety profile of this RFA approach with no immediate complications.
